Output 3e7b4b37a36dc92b053777667eb53cb8c553d479695261a05b40e05a902ae8f7:0

value
2588815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3937c00af901640bf9ea856ed622e8f1599175 OP_EQUAL
address
3Jkxpybp7nyr5gMHqJ2Zh7Ddqw6KkVtCK7
transaction
3e7b4b37a36dc92b053777667eb53cb8c553d479695261a05b40e05a902ae8f7
spent
true